+/* Convert eight-bit chars in SRC (in multibyte form) to the
+ corresponding byte and store in DST. CHARS is the number of
+ characters in SRC. The value is the number of bytes stored in DST.
+ Usually, the value is the same as CHARS, but is less than it if SRC
+ contains a non-ASCII, non-eight-bit characater. If ACCEPT_LATIN_1
+ is nonzero, a Latin-1 character is accepted and converted to a byte
+ of that character code. */
+
+EMACS_INT
+str_to_unibyte (src, dst, chars, accept_latin_1)
+ const unsigned char *src;
+ unsigned char *dst;
+ EMACS_INT chars;
+ int accept_latin_1;
+{
+ EMACS_INT i;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< chars; i++)
+ {
+ int c = STRING_CHAR_ADVANCE (src);
+
+ if (CHAR_BYTE8_P (c))
+ c = CHAR_TO_BYTE8 (c);
+ else if (! ASCII_CHAR_P (c)
+ && (! accept_latin_1 || c >= 0x100))
+ return i;
+ *dst++ = c;
+ }
+ return i;
+}
